Best Buy

Best Buy, originally founded in 1966 as Sound of Music is now a multinational American consumer electronics retailer. The company offers a variety of products, including TVs, home theatre systems, laptops, computers, cameras, smartphones and video games. B&H Photo Video

If you're looking to buy electronics online, you should visit the B&H Photo Video website. The camera superstore has numerous tutorials, videos and reviews that will help you choose the right product for your requirements. It also offers a wide collection of used equipment that will help you save money or fill out your wish list. It is also known for its outstanding customer service.

The B&H website is simple to navigate and has a search feature. The company has a blog which provides the latest information on technology. It has a broad selection of cameras, lenses and other accessories that include professional-grade items. It also provides a wide selection of shipping options as well as free returns.
